Why Traditional Metals Fail in the Deep

Marine and offshore engineering represent some of the most demanding operational environments on the planet. Equipment deployed in these sectors—ranging from deep-water oil rigs and subsea manifolds to coastal desalination plants—faces a relentless triad of destructive forces: severe saltwater corrosion, immense hydrostatic pressure, and aggressive biofouling. Traditional materials, such as carbon steel, standard stainless steel, and even copper-nickel alloys, inevitably succumb to these harsh conditions over time. The presence of chloride ions in seawater acts as a powerful catalyst for pitting, crevice corrosion, and stress corrosion cracking (SCC), leading to catastrophic failures, costly downtime, and severe environmental hazards.

Furthermore, as the offshore oil and gas industry pushes into ultra-deepwater territories (frequently exceeding depths of 3,000 meters), the hydrostatic pressure increases exponentially. Materials must possess an extraordinary strength-to-weight ratio to prevent structural collapse while remaining light enough to facilitate installation and reduce the overall payload on floating platforms. Why Seamless Titanium Tubes?

The metallurgical superiority of titanium, combined with the structural integrity of seamless manufacturing, creates a product that defies the limitations of traditional marine metallurgy.

🛡️

Absolute Corrosion Immunity

Titanium naturally forms a highly tenacious, continuous, and self-healing protective oxide film (TiO2) instantly upon exposure to oxygen or moisture. In seawater, this passive layer renders seamless titanium tubes practically immune to localized corrosion, galvanic corrosion, and microbiologically influenced corrosion (MIC), ensuring a lifespan that often exceeds the operational life of the offshore platform itself.

⚙️

Seamless Structural Integrity

Unlike welded tubes, which possess a heat-affected zone (HAZ) that can become a focal point for stress concentration and chemical attack, Seamless Titanium Tubes are extruded from a single solid billet. This homogeneous micro-structure provides uniform mechanical properties, making them capable of withstanding extreme internal and external pressures without the risk of seam rupture in deep-sea pipelines.

⚖️

Exceptional Strength-to-Weight

Titanium is approximately 45% lighter than steel but offers comparable or superior tensile strength. In offshore engineering, weight reduction is critical. Lighter subsea risers and piping systems significantly reduce the tensioner load requirements on floating production storage and offloading (FPSO) units, cutting down massive structural costs and simplifying subsea installation logistics.

In-Depth Application Scenarios

Real-world Applications

Powering the Ocean Economy

1. Offshore Oil & Gas Production (FPSO & Subsea Tiebacks): Seamless titanium tubes are extensively used in high-pressure, high-temperature (HPHT) subsea wells. They serve as dynamic risers, production flowlines, and hydraulic control lines. Their resistance to sour gas (H2S) and carbon dioxide (CO2) makes them indispensable for modern oil extraction.

2. Marine Heat Exchangers & Condensers: Onboard ships and offshore platforms, space is at a premium. Titanium’s high thermal conductivity and resistance to erosion-corrosion allow for the design of highly compact, thin-walled shell-and-tube heat exchangers. They handle cooling water at high flow velocities without the risk of impingement attack.

3. Seawater Desalination Plants: In Multi-Stage Flash (MSF) and Reverse Osmosis (RO) desalination, seamless titanium tubes are utilized in the heat recovery and brine heater sections. Their ability to withstand highly concentrated, boiling brine ensures decades of maintenance-free operation, drastically lowering the total cost of water production.

4. Deep-Sea Submersibles (ROVs/AUVs): The extreme hydrostatic pressure at the bottom of the ocean requires materials that will not buckle. Titanium seamless tubes are used for the pressure housings and buoyancy control systems of remotely operated vehicles, protecting sensitive electronic equipment from the crushing depths.

The Economic Shift: CAPEX vs. OPEX

Historically, the high initial capital expenditure (CAPEX) of titanium deterred widespread use, relegating it to highly specialized military or aerospace applications. However, the commercial landscape in marine engineering has undergone a paradigm shift. Industry leaders now calculate costs based on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) and operational expenditure (OPEX). When factoring in the costs of regular maintenance, protective coatings, cathodic protection systems, and catastrophic downtime caused by failing steel pipes, Seamless Titanium Tubes prove to be highly economical. The return on investment (ROI) is realized rapidly, as titanium systems offer a "fit-and-forget" lifecycle spanning 40 to 50 years.

The global supply chain has also matured. Advanced forging and extrusion technologies have optimized the yield rates of titanium billets, stabilizing market prices. The demand for specific grades—such as Grade 7 (palladium-alloyed for extreme crevice corrosion resistance) and Grade 9 (half the weight of steel but high strength for hydraulics)—is surging in the offshore sector.

Future Horizon

Pioneering the Green Blue Economy

Looking toward the future, the application of seamless titanium tubes is expanding beyond traditional oil and gas. The rise of the Green Blue Economy is driving new demand:

Offshore Wind & Green Hydrogen: As offshore wind farms move further out to sea, there is a growing trend to integrate hydrogen electrolysis platforms directly onto the wind turbines. Seamless titanium tubes are critical for handling the highly corrosive seawater intake and the pure oxygen/hydrogen outputs safely.

Ocean Thermal Energy Conversion (OTEC): OTEC systems require massive heat exchangers to exploit the temperature difference between deep cold ocean water and warm surface water. The sheer volume of seawater processed makes titanium the only viable material to ensure long-term efficiency without biofouling degradation.

Deep-Sea Mining: As the world transitions to electric vehicles, the race to mine polymetallic nodules from the ocean floor is accelerating. The riser pipes used to transport highly abrasive and corrosive slurries from 5,000 meters deep rely heavily on the wear and corrosion resistance of thick-walled seamless titanium tubes.
